Huawei introduced a chain of foldable phones with original Huawei Mate X, that accomplishes something extraordinary and is now followed by the Huawei Mate X2. This extraordinary phone series folds the opposite way to the popular Samsung Galaxy Z Fold 3, means the display wraps around the outside of the body when folded. Already exhibited by the Mate Xs 2’s predecessor, this unique, wraparound foldable design has various benefits which include a slender body, a bigger tablet screen, and a great front display in smartphone mode. That competes with 25:9 cover screen on the Galaxy Z Fold 2 and Z Fold 3 that is quite narrow.

Regardless of its benefits, in any case, there’s no avoiding the fact that an external folding screen is more at risk of damage than an inner-folding screen. Moreover, it has no Google services or 5G, and is more expensive than the Z Fold series.

Huawei Mate Xs 2 specs at a glance:

Body: Unfolded: 156.5×139.3×5.4mm; folded: 156.5×75.5×11.1mm; 255g.

Display: 7.80″ Foldable OLED, 1B colors, 120Hz, 2200x2480px resolution, 10.15:9 aspect ratio, 424ppi; folded display: 6.50″, 1176x2480px, 19:9 aspect ratio.

Chipset: Qualcomm SM8350 Snapdragon 888 4G (5 nm): Octa-core (1×2.84 GHz Cortex-X1 & 3×2.42 GHz Cortex-A78 & 4×1.80 GHz Cortex-A55); Adreno 660.

Memory: 256GB 8GB RAM, 512GB 8GB RAM, 512GB 12GB RAM; UFS; NM (Nano Memory), up to 256GB (uses shared SIM slot).

OS/Software: HarmonyOS 2.0.

Rear camera: Wide (main): 50 MP, f/1.8, PDAF, Laser AF; Ultra wide angle: 13 MP, f/2.2, 120˚; Telephoto: 8 MP, f/2.4, 81mm, PDAF, OIS, 3x optical zoom.

Front camera: 10.7 MP, f/2.2.

Video capture: Rear camera: 4K@30/60fps, 1080p@30/60/960fps; Front camera: 4K@30/60fps, 1080p@30/60/240fps.

Battery: 4600mAh; Fast charging 66W, Reverse charging.

Misc: Fingerprint reader (side-mounted); NFC; Infrared port.

Design

The Huawei Mate Xs 2 when unfolded is quite thin, 5.4mm across its body. That’s even slimmer than the 6.4mm Galaxy Z Fold 3. the Mate Xs 2. When Mate Xs 2 is in completely open state, it looks like a small tablet which shuts quite smoothly.

The new model’s weight is  only 255g, which is hardly heavier than an iPhone 13 Pro Max (240g). The Mate Xs 2 actually returns when unlatched from shut to open, thus doesn’t offer the range of folding angles  accessible on Samsung’s foldables. Its Falcon Wing pivot isn’t intended to be half-open.

Display

The flexible display turns both into tablet screen and the phone screen, which implies that when in phone mode, the back of the phone is also partly screen. The screen is 7.8 inches when open, and 6.5 inches when closed. This is helpful in certain instances but the shortcoming is that foldable screens are generally delicate.

Rear: The phone’s rear, on the flip of the screen, is a cross-hatch textured fiberglass material, and the rest of the frame has no buttons and ports.

Front: Huawei claims to have improved the durability of the display having a four-layered system that feels more like glass than the more distorted Mate Xs. It has a 120Hz OLED screen with a pixel density of 424 pixels per inch.

Controls: On the right side, there is a thick strip with USB-C port, a volume rocker and power button which doubles up as a fingerprint scanner along the side, and the cameras on the back.

Cameras

Huawei’s known for its incredible camera technology with a 50MP main camera with an f/1.8 lens which provides dynamic results. The other 8MP telephoto camera with a 3.4x optical zoom, matched with an f/2.4 lens, also gives great results and a 13MP ultra-wide camera with an f/2.2 lens, struggles with good results at night.

Front Cam: Most prominent is the punch-hole selfie camera on the phone’s display. This intrudes on the premium screen design but it does work much better. You will not need to open it up for video calls or to take a selfie. The photography results are just fine though.

Video Cam: The Mate Xs 2 records video up to 4K60 with its main and ultrawide rear cameras. The tele is capped at 4K30, though a zoomed in 4K60 mode is accessible as well. There’s no 8K recording capability.

Performance and software

Huawei’s Mate Xs 2 and the entire series runs EMUI, Huawei’s layer over Android, which of course has no access to the Google Play Store and Google Play services. However, investing heavily in its AppGallery, Huawei features Petal Search, which allows you the access to most of the apps like Disney Plus, Netflix, and Instagram etc.

The phone’s processor is Qualcomm Snapdragon 888 4G, a 2021 flagship processor with 5G disabled. This does affect the overall performance of phone as compared to other premium phones.

Battery and charging

The phone’s battery is a 4,600mAh cell, with the phone charging at up to 66W. Huawei’s folding flagship also misses out on wireless charging, however, its slightly larger battery than the Z Fold 3 is a great support.
